FOLFOX and U0126 co-treatment significantly reduces long-term survival of reduced SPTAN1-expressing cells. Cells seeded at 1 × 10 3 per cell culture flask (surface area 25 cm 2 ) were incubated until adhesion and cultivated in medium supplemented with or without 10 μM of U0126 for 18 h. Then, cells were treated with FOLFOX supplemented with or without 10 μM of U0126 for 24 h, 48 h and 72 h. Subsequently, the medium was replaced and cells were cultivated in medium without supplements for a further seven days. Colonies were fixed with 4% paraformaldehyde and stained with 0.5% crystal violet. The number of colonies was quantified using the COLCOUNT TM system and Oxford Optronix ColCount software version 4.3.5.1. Columns show the mean number of colonies ± SD of reduced SPTAN1-expressing cells (shSPTAN1_3 blue columns) in comparison to the pLKO.1-transduced controls (pink columns). Co-treatment of U0126 and FOLFOX for 48 h as well as 72 h significantly inhibited the colony formation of all cell lines. p -values were calculated using one-way ANOVA; n = 3. The following p -values were considered as statistically significant: ns = not significant, * p < 0.05.
